Ingredients

Delicious grilled halloumi skewers infused with bright lemon and aromatic thyme, perfect as an appetizer or side dish.

For the Halloumi Skewers

  • 1 pound halloumi cheese
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on fresh thyme leaves, chopped
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• Wooden skewers

How to Make Grilled Halloumi Skewers-Lemon Thyme Flavor

Step 1: Prepare the Halloumi

  1. Slice the halloumi cheese into roughly 1-inch cubes. Aim for uniformity in size to ensure even cooking.

Step 2: Make the Marinade

  1. In a medium-sized bowl, whisk together the olive oil, fresh lemon juice, chopped fresh thyme leaves, black pepper, and salt until well combined.

Step 3: Marinate the Cheese

  1. Add the cubed halloumi cheese to the bowl with the lemon-thyme mixture.
  2. Gently toss to ensure each piece is thoroughly coated.
  3. Marinate for at least 15 to 30 minutes at room temperature.

Step 4: Prepare the Skewers

  1. Soak wooden skewers in water for at least 30 minutes before grilling to prevent burning.
  2. Thread the marinated halloumi cubes onto the soaked skewers, leaving a little space between each cube.

Step 5: Grill the Skewers

  1. Preheat your grill to medium-high heat.
  2. Lightly oil the grill grates.
  3. Place the halloumi skewers on the hot grill and cook for approximately 2 to 4 minutes per side until golden-brown grill marks appear and the cheese is tender.

Step 6: Serve

  1. Remove skewers from the grill and serve immediately.
  2. Garnish with extra fresh thyme leaves if desired.

How to Perfect Grilled Halloumi Skewers-Lemon Thyme Flavor

To achieve the best results when making Grilled Halloumi Skewers with Lemon Thyme Flavor, consider the following tips.

  • Use Fresh Ingredients: Always opt for fresh halloumi and herbs. Fresh ingredients enhance the flavor significantly.
  • Marinate for Longer: While 30 minutes is sufficient, allowing the halloumi to marinate for up to two hours deepens the flavor.
  • Preheat Your Grill: Ensure your grill is preheated to medium-high heat for optimal cooking. This helps achieve perfect grill marks.
  • Mind the Cooking Time: Keep an eye on the skewers while grilling; they can cook quickly. Aim for that golden-brown color without overcooking.
  • Soak Skewers Properly: Soak wooden skewers long enough to avoid burning on the grill; this ensures safe and effective grilling.
  • Garnish with Fresh Herbs: Adding extra thyme or lemon zest just before serving enhances both presentation and flavor.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

When making Grilled Halloumi Skewers-Lemon Thyme Flavor, avoiding common mistakes can enhance your dish’s taste and presentation.

  • Not using fresh ingredients: Fresh thyme and lemon provide the best flavor. Always opt for fresh over dried when possible.
  • Skipping the marination step: Marinating halloumi allows it to absorb flavors. Don’t rush this step; aim for at least 15 minutes.
  • Overcrowding the skewers: Leaving space between halloumi cubes ensures even cooking. Avoid squeezing too many pieces on one skewer.
  • Grilling at too high a temperature: Medium-high heat is ideal. Too hot can burn the cheese before it cooks through, ruining its texture.
  • Neglecting to soak wooden skewers: Soaking prevents burning during grilling. Always soak them in water for at least 30 minutes prior to use.

Refrigerator Storage

  • Store grilled halloumi skewers in an airtight container in the refrigerator.
  • They can last up to 3 days when properly stored.

Freezing Grilled Halloumi Skewers-Lemon Thyme Flavor

  • Wrap each skewer in plastic wrap or aluminum foil tightly.
  • Place the wrapped skewers in a freezer-safe container or bag.
  • They can be frozen for up to 2 months.

Reheating Grilled Halloumi Skewers-Lemon Thyme Flavor

  • Oven: Preheat to 350°F (175°C). Place skewers on a baking sheet and heat for about 10 minutes until warmed through.
  • Microwave: Use medium power for about 1-2 minutes, checking frequently to avoid overcooking.
  • Stovetop: Heat a skillet over medium heat. Add skewers and cook for a few minutes until heated, turning occasionally.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I make Grilled Halloumi Skewers-Lemon Thyme Flavor vegetarian?

Grilled halloumi is already vegetarian. Ensure all additional ingredients are also vegetarian-friendly.

Can I use other herbs instead of thyme?

Yes! Feel free to experiment with herbs like oregano or rosemary for a different flavor profile while keeping the lemon zest.

What sides pair well with Grilled Halloumi Skewers-Lemon Thyme Flavor?

Serve these skewers alongside salads, grilled vegetables, or crusty bread for a delightful meal.

How long can I marinate the halloumi?

You can marinate halloumi for up to an hour. However, if you’re short on time, even 15-30 minutes will infuse decent flavor.
